PR

Reddit見どころ:Web開発・サーバー (2026年03月29日 Dinner)

Web開発・サーバー
Web開発・サーバー
この記事は約11分で読めます。
記事内に広告が含まれています。

AI がプログラムする楽しさを奪ったのか?

👨‍💻
AI ツールのおかげでコードを書く速度は格段に上がりましたが、デバッグやロジック設計をする際の「発見の喜び」が薄れてしまった気がします。もう自分たちの手で何かを創っている実感が湧かないのです。

💡
ツールを使うか使わないかで楽しさが変わるのではなく、何に集中するかの問題だと思います。単純な実装作業から解放されれば、むしろアーキテクチャなど本質的な部分により深く没頭できるはずです。

このスレッドでは、開発者が AI ツールの導入によってコードを書くプロセスそのものから得られるカタルシスが失われたと嘆く意見が多く見られました。特に初心者の頃から培ってきたデバッグの快感や、ロジックを設計する喜びが薄れていくことへの不安感が根強く存在しています。しかし、単純な記述作業から解放され、システムアーキテクチャという高次元の問題に集中できるという利点も無視できません。

私自身も、以前は手動でロジックを組み立てていた頃の方が楽しかったと感じることがありますが、現在は生成されたコードの修正や統合に時間を費やすことで、より広い視野を持つことができています。この議論は単なるツールの是非を超え、エンジニアという職人精神そのものの定義を問い直す契機となっています。

創造性の代償としての効率化

プログラミングにおける楽しさの源泉は、往々にして困難な課題を自ら解決した時の達成感にあります。しかし AI がそれを代理で実行可能にする時代において、その達成感がどこに存在するかが問われています。学習プロセスとしてのコード記述という側面は無視できない課題です。

多くの回答者が指摘するように、単純な実装作業から解放され、設計やアーキテクチャといったより本質的な部分にリソースを割けるようになるのは、長期的には開発者の成長にも寄与する可能性があります。結局のところ、ツールが人間を置き換えるのではなく、人間の能力をどう拡張するかという視点で捉え直す必要があります。

日本のエンジニアリング文化への影響

日本の開発現場では、依然としてコードの美しさを重視する文化が残っています。そのため、AI によって生成されたコードが可読性を損なわないかという懸念も根強いです。しかし、グローバル競争の中で迅速にプロトタイプを構築する必要性が高まっており、AI ツールの活用は避けて通れない選択になりつつあります。

私たちが目指すべきは、ツールを使いこなす能力と、伝統的なエンジニアリングの知見を融合させることにあると考えます。日本のソフトウェア産業が未来に持続的に成長するためには、この変化を前向きに捉え、新たな価値観を構築していくことが不可欠です。

💡 Geek-Relish のおすすめ:
AI によるコーディング支援で生産性を最大化する IDE ツールを活用して、より本質的な開発業務へとリソースを集中させるのが賢明な選択です。
Cursor の公式サイト・詳細はこちら

インディーズ開発者が Lighthouse 100 に執念を燃やすべきか?

👨‍💻
インディーズ開発であれば SEO を無視できません。Lighthouse スコアの改善は検索順位に直結するため、100 点を目指す価値は十分にあります。時間を惜しんではいけません。

💡
ユーザーはスコアよりも実際の体験を重視します。過度な最適化で機能性が損なわれたり、開発時間が膨大になったりするリスクの方が問題ではないでしょうか。

Lighthouse スコアの 100 点追求がインディーズ開発者にとって有効かどうかという議論が活発に行われています。多くのユーザーは数値よりも実際の体験や機能性を重視しており、極端な最適化がリソースの無駄になるとする声も上がっています。

しかし、SEO における検索順位への影響を無視することはできず、特に新規顧客を獲得するためにこのスコアが重要な指標となる場合もあります。開発者の時間投資対効果をどう評価するかという視点で、それぞれのプロジェクトの状況に合わせて判断を下す必要があります。

数値最適化と実用性の狭間

パフォーマンス最適化はユーザー体験に直結する重要な要素ですが、その追求が目的化してしまうと本末転倒になるリスクがあります。特にモバイル環境では通信速度や端末性能の制約があり、過度なアニメーションやリッチな画像が負荷となるケースも珍しくありません。

Google のアルゴリズム改定によって Core Web Vitals が重視されるようになり、技術的な正しさがビジネス成果に直結する時代となりました。しかし、完璧主義よりも、ユーザーにとっての価値を最優先するバランス感覚が求められるようになっています。

日本のローカル検索環境との相性

日本市場では Google 検索への依存度が高く、SEO 対策が不可欠です。そのため Lighthouse スコアの改善は、国内ユーザーへのリーチを広げる手段として有効な側面があります。

一方で、日本の web ユーザーは非常に高い水準を求めており、細部まで作り込まれたコンテンツに満足感を得る傾向が強いです。そのため、スコアだけでなく、ローカルなユーザーニーズに応じた UX デザインとのバランスが重要になります。

最終的には、開発のゴールが収益化なのか学習目的なのかによって判断基準は変わります。日本のインディーズ市場でも生き残るためには、技術的な美意識とビジネス戦略の両方を統合したアプローチが必要です。

💡 Geek-Relish のおすすめ:
パフォーマンススコアを自動で最適化するホスティングプラットフォームを利用すれば、開発効率を保ちつつ検索性能も確保できます。
Vercel の公式サイト・詳細はこちら

リストベース fantasy RPG が示す API の美しき可能性

👨‍💻
REST ベースで RPG を作るなんて面白い!状態管理をサーバー側で行うことで、改ざん防止やデータ永続性が容易になりそう。ただしリアルタイム性は確保できるの?

💡
API の設計次第だが、複雑なゲームロジックを全て REST で扱うのは現実的ではないのでは?状態同期の仕組みが非常に重要になる気がする。

REST ベース fantasy RPG の作成例は、API を通じてゲームの状態を管理するユニークなアプローチを示しています。従来のクライアントサイド依存のアーキテクチャとは異なり、サーバーとの通信がゲームプレイの中心となる点に注目が集まっています。

これにより、マルチプラットフォーム対応やデータ永続性が容易になり、シームレスな体験を提供できます。ただし、リアルタイム性の欠如やレイテンシーへの対策など、技術的な課題も多数存在します。

私はウェブ技術をゲームの基盤として再定義する可能性を感じました。単純な API 呼び出しの積み重ねが、どのようにして没入感のある世界観を生み出すかという探究は非常に興味深いものです。

サーバーサイドロジックのゲーム化

サーバーサイドロジックをゲーム化することは、従来のクライアントサイド処理の限界を超える新しい表現形式です。状態管理を外部で行うことで、改ざん対策やクロスプラットフォームの一貫性といったメリットが得られます。

しかし、ネットワーク依存度が高まるため、オフライン機能の実装や通信エラーへのフォールバック処理など、堅牢性の確保が求められます。また、ゲームプレイヤーとしての没入感を損なわないインタラクション設計も課題です。

サーバーレスアーキテクチャやマイクロサービスとの親和性が高く、拡張性の高いゲームエコシステムを構築できる可能性があります。この発想が、新たなジャンルを生む可能性を示唆しています。

日本のファンタジー作品との親和性

日本のファンタジー作品は、複雑な世界観とキャラクター造形に定評があります。REST ベースの形式であれば、テキストベースやブラウザゲームとの相性が良く、手軽に挑戦できるプラットフォームとして期待されています。

また、日本の開発者たちは既存の技術スタックを組み合わせることに長けています。このプロジェクトは、その知識を活かして新しい体験を生み出すための良いケーススタディとなるでしょう。

将来的には、AI と REST API を組み合わせたインタラクティブなストーリーテリングが主流になるかもしれません。日本の読者にとっても、技術と物語の融合というテーマは非常に興味深いものとなるはずです。

💡 Geek-Relish のおすすめ:
RESTful なゲームロジックを構築するためのデータベースサービスを活用し、堅牢で拡張性のあるアーキテクチャを実現しましょう。
DigitalOcean Databases の公式サイト・詳細はこちら

コメント

タイトルとURLをコピーしました